Dr Nimmons is an Alzheimer's Society funded Clinical Research Fellow in General Practice. Her mixed methods PhD is exploring the identification of anxiety and depression in people living with dementia in primary care. Her research interests are in the care of older people, including dementia, Parkinson’s Disease and frailty. She also has an interest in health inequalities, public engagement and undergraduate medical education. She studied medicine at the University of Manchester, where she also gained an MRes in Medical Sciences with Distinction. She continues to work as a GP alongside her PhD.
